英文摘要
We designed a dual-protease biosensor for two different protease activities using doubly inhibited split-GFP, which was fully activated only when two proteases were present at the same time. In the system, N- and C-terminal fragments of split-GFP of split-luciferase were cyclized via the distinct protease substrate sequences, respectively. The simultaneous addition of two proteases resulted in cleavage of both substrate linkers, leading to the functional recovery of split-GFP and split-luciferase. These results clearly demonstrate the successful construction of the dual-protease biosensor for two different caspase activities by using split-GFP and split-luciferase.
